Tilt
Our mission is to make fashion accessible to all and inspire everyone to dress a little better. We believe e-commerce is in a rut, with brands lost in a decades-long void, lacking innovation, and mindlessly redesigning websites without fixing the real issue — making shopping fun and affordable.
Today, we are the UK\’s biggest live shopping platform focused on making shopping a joyful, social experience that brings people together and helps everyone level up their style. We\’ve raised an $18m Series A, and we\’re rapidly growing and looking to hire A-players to build the future of shopping.

Technical stack and tools
-
Our frontend is built with VueJS and TypeScript
-
On the backend we mainly use NodeJS
-
On mobile we use native iOS (Swift, SwiftUI and UIKit) and native Android (Kotlin and Jetpack Compose) with a shared layer of KMP
-
Other core technologies include AWS, Express, Vite, and Webpack, NPM, Cypress, GraphQL, and more
